Cleaning the Jaliscazo brush
The Jaliscazo brush is designed for both long and pet hair, as well as carpets, hard oors and
removal of ne and coarse dirt. Its micro-bre technology captures dust, sand, mites and lint
eciently in a single pass. This brush is in contact with the oor, and therefore with dirt, so it
can be worn out over time, aecting negatively to the cleaning eciency.
1. Slightly press the Jaliscazo brush frame tabs in order to open the slot and remove it. Fig. 25
2. Remove any hair, lint or other dirt trapped in the brush and around the shafts.
3. Clear and clean the robot suction channel. Fig. 26
4. Reinstall the Jaliscazo brush and its frame.
Side brushes
Side brushes are designed with multiple bristles and are used to push dirt towards the
suction nozzle and to thoroughly clean edges and corners. These brushes can wear out over
time, aecting negatively to the cleaning eciency. For this reason, it is suggested to replace
each side brush after a maximum of 220 hours or less.
Recommendation
It is recommended to clean the side brushes once a week with the help of the autoclean brush.
Sensors
- Your robot vacuum cleaner has dierent types of sensors, for example, proximity sensors
that allow the robot to move around while detecting obstacles, or free-fall sensors that
help the robot detect slopes or possible gaps/unevenness such as staircases. These
sensors are always in contact with dust particles, and therefore can be blocked over time,
causing possible navigation errors.
- It is suggested to clean all the robot sensors with the cleaning brush or with a dry, soft
cloth after a maximum of 35 hours of operation or less.
Battery charge and replacement
To lengthen the battery shelf life, keep the robot charging on the charging base when not in use.
Remove the battery and store it in a safe, dry place if the device will not be used for a long
period of time.
To replace the battery, follow the instructions below:
1. Unscrew the 2 screws on the battery slot, remove the battery cover and the battery. Fig. 27
2. Insert the new battery with the battery label facing up. Fig. 28
3. Place the battery and the battery cover in its place and x properly the screws back again.

High-eciency lter. Fig. 24
- The high-eciency lter is designed with bres that help trap dust particles, dust
mites, pollen... It is very important to periodically clean the lter, to avoid these particles
from building up in the lter, causing eciency loss. It is convenient to carry out this
maintenance once a week.
- It is recommended to replace the high-eciency lter with a new one without exceeding
160 cleaning hours.
Recommendation
Dirt can be removed with a small brush or by shaking carefully against a hard surface for dust
to fall o. The high-eciency lter cannot be washed.
Mesh primary lter and sponge lter
The ltering system is featured with a primary mesh lter and a sponge lter, located next to
the high-eciency lter. It is suggested to replace them either after a maximum of 160 hours
of use or when they are worn out due to operation.
Recommendation
Dirt can be removed with a small brush or by shaking carefully against a hard surface for dust
to fall o. You can also use warm water without detergents to obtain better results. Always
make sure they are completely dry before installing them again; otherwise, moisture can
reach the robot motor and damage it.
